To quote: "All British Citizens have the right of abode in the United Kingdom. If, as a British Citizen, you wish to travel on a non-British passport it must be endorsed to show that you have the right of abode. Otherwise, you might experience difficulty proving your right to be re-admitted to the United Kingdom."

https://assets.publishing.service.gov.uk/government/uploads/system/uploads/attachment_data/file/798226/Dual_nationality_information.pdf

Summary, expect some hassle and the possible need to visit the port armed with evidence that she's your daughter.

My wife has German / UK dual nationality.  She doesn't have a UK passport.  She's never had any issues getting back into the UK on her German one.  However, she has been asked if she has residency a couple of times (once by Dutch border police last year, once by UK border people this year).  Each time, saying that she had UK nationality was enough and was not challenged.

We agreed that, if she looked different (black, young / male, Roma, etc, etc) things might not have been so easy, and it probably was time to get a UK passport to save future hassle.
